The Complexity of the Medical Licensing Process

Every state in the United States has its own medical board with distinct statutes, rules, and requirements. For a physician seeking to practice in multiple states or relocate, the documents can become frustrating. A common application requires main source verification of medical school transcripts, postgraduate training assessments, exam scores (USMLE/COMLEX), and background checks.

The Step-by-Step Managed Licensing Journey

Relinquishing the administrative tasks of licensing follows a structured course developed to reduce the physician's participation while making the most of accuracy.

  1. Initial Consultation: The service examines the doctor's history, including any potential "warnings" (such as spaces in training or past malpractice claims) that might complicate the procedure.
  2. Document Collection: The doctor supplies a basic CV and signs the needed authorizations. The service then takes the lead in gathering transcripts and certifications.
  3. Application Preparation: Specialists submit the state-specific kinds, making sure that the chronology of the physician's career is perfectly represented.
  4. Primary Source Verification (PSV): This is the most lengthy phase. The service contacts the Federation of State Medical Boards (FSMB), the ECFMG (for worldwide graduates), and medical schools to validate qualifications straight.
  5. Submission and Follow-up: The service submits the final package and keeps a routine cadence of interaction with the board's licensing expert until the license is released.

Comprehending State Board Requirements

While the procedure can be managed by others, the underlying requirements stay firm. Below is a general overview of what physicians need to satisfy to qualify for a hassle-free transition into a brand-new state.

Table 2: Common State Medical Board Requirements

CategoryStandard RequirementPurpose
EducationGraduation from an LCME or COCA recognized school.Makes sure basic medical training.
Postgraduate Training1 to 3 years of ACGME-accredited residency.Verifies scientific proficiency.
EvaluationsPassing ratings on USMLE, COMLEX, or LMCC.Standardized knowledge assessment.
Background CheckFingerprinting and NPDB inquiry.Confirmation of ethical and legal standing.
RecommendationsPeer suggestions or "Forms of Evaluation."Evaluation of professional conduct.

How long does the problem-free process take?

While the administrative deal with the physician's end is minimized, state boards still have their own processing times. Generally, a state license takes in between 60 to 120 days. Utilizing a service ensures there are no unnecessary delays due to errors, which can frequently shave weeks off the overall time.
